The Magic of AI Upscaling

Upscaling is an image processing technique traditionally used to increase the resolution of an image. However, AI upscaling goes beyond simple interpolation. AI upscalers like Magnific AI use machine learning algorithms trained on vast sets of images to predict and add details that would be present in higher resolution versions.

Magnific AI, in particular, stands out for not only producing realistic-looking images from pixelated sources but also for capturing and enhancing all the elements of the original image. This integrity in upscaling has been a significant pain point in the past. Achieving an image that reflects the true essence of the original, from the colors and clothing to the contextual background details, is what sets these AI tools apart.

A Detailed Look at Capabilities and User Experience

Both platforms sport intuitive interfaces and allow for creative control over the upscaling process. Magnific AI provides several sliders such as 'Creativity', 'HDR', and 'Resemblance' which allow users to influence how the AI interprets the original image. Korea AI, on the other hand, offers 'AI Strength' and 'Upscaling Factor' adjustments, presenting users with the ability to fine-tune the upscaling process.

The experience with both platforms highlights the importance of the initial input—in this case, a precise prompt that guides the AI. A well-crafted prompt can result in a much more accurate and faithful enhancement, while a vague or erroneous one can lead to less desirable outcomes.

Pricing Models: Free vs. Paid Services

Magnific AI's pricing model presents a steep $40 per month for its lowest plan, which gives users a limited number of upscales. This cost, especially compared to Korea AI's free service, might be hard to justify for individual artists or small businesses. Challenges and Considerations

Despite the impressive advancements, there remains a gap between upscale reproductions and the unmatched quality of high-resolution originals. The AI still has hurdles to overcome, such as maintaining accuracy in complex textures and avoiding the introduction of unintended artifacts. Moreover, reliance on textual prompts and user input signifies that there's still room for enhancing AI's intuitive understanding of visual content.
